为什么腾讯云轻量服务器卡?

腾讯云轻量应用服务器出现卡顿现象可能由多种因素引起,包括但不限于资源分配不足、网络问题、软件配置不当等。理解这些原因有助于采取有效措施解决问题,优化服务器性能。

资源分配不足

首先,资源分配不足是导致服务器卡顿最常见的原因之一。轻量应用服务器通常提供有限的CPU、内存和磁盘空间,以满足中小型应用的基本需求。当应用程序的负载超过服务器的处理能力时,就会出现响应缓慢或卡顿的情况。例如,如果您的网站访问量突然激增,而服务器的CPU和内存没有相应地进行升级,就可能导致服务器无法及时响应请求,从而产生卡顿现象。

网络问题

其次,网络问题是另一个常见的影响因素。网络延迟或不稳定可以显著降低数据传输速度,导致用户体验下降。对于依赖外部API或数据库的应用程序来说,网络问题尤为关键。如果服务器与这些服务之间的连接不稳定,可能会导致请求超时或失败,进而影响整体性能。此外,服务器所在的数据中心地理位置也可能影响到网络性能,选择距离用户较近的数据中心可以减少网络延迟。

软件配置不当

最后,软件配置不当也是造成服务器卡顿的重要原因之一。这包括操作系统设置、Web服务器配置、数据库优化等方面。例如,不合理的数据库查询语句可能会消耗大量资源,导致服务器负载增加;错误的Web服务器配置可能导致静态文件加载缓慢;操作系统层面的安全设置过于严格,可能会影响某些合法请求的处理效率。因此,对应用程序及其运行环境进行全面的性能调优是非常必要的。

解决方案建议

针对上述问题,可以采取以下措施来改善服务器性能:

  1. 合理规划资源:根据实际业务需求评估并调整服务器资源配置,必要时升级至更高规格。
  2. 优化网络环境:选择合适的地域部署服务器,并考虑使用CDN提速服务来提高内容分发效率。
  3. 精细化软件调优:定期审查和优化应用程序代码及配置,确保其高效运行。
  4. 监控与维护:建立有效的监控机制,及时发现并解决潜在问题,保持系统的稳定性和安全性。

通过以上方法,可以有效地缓解甚至消除腾讯云轻量应用服务器的卡顿问题,提升用户体验。